Decision XXXV/9: Abating emissions of carbon tetrachloride Document type Decision Reference number XXXV/9 Date Oct 27, 2023 SourceUNEP, InforMEA Status Active Subject Waste & hazardous substances, Air & atmosphere Treaty Montreal Protocol on Substances that Deplete the Ozone Layer (Sep 16, 1987) Meeting Thirty-Fifth Meeting of the Parties Website ozone.unep.org Abstract Taking note of the 2023 progress report from the Technology and Economic Assessment Panel containing the information on sources and emissions of carbon tetrachloride, To request the Technology and Economic Assessment Panel, in consultation with the Scientific Assessment Panel, to provide in its 2024 progress report an update on the emissions of carbon tetrachloride, including the following: Emissions by source categories, including emissions as a percentage of total production of carbon tetrachloride with a description of the methodology used by the Panel; Updated information on alternatives for carbon tetrachloride use as feedstock applications including information on technical feasibility, economic viability, safety, and sustainability; Updated information on best practices and technologies for minimizing carbon tetrachloride emissions.
